Euphonic Audio iAMP 600

Sign in to disble this ad
***Price dropped to $475 shipped!!!

Euphonic Audio iAMP 600, in great condition. White face USA made model.

Features:
600 watts rms @ 4ohms, 1800 watts peak.
Input Level with meter
Active/Passive inputs
4 preset tone options
EQ bypass
4 band "Tone Shaping" section
Output control with clip LED
Effects Loop
Built-in Sabine tuner
Tuner out
Mute footswitch in
